UCL: Ronaldo’s Magic Sinks Juventus
Cristiano Ronaldo put up another spectacular display yesterday as he scored twice to help Real Madrid record a 3-0 win over 10-man Juventus in the first leg of their Champions League quarter-final in Turin.
Ronaldo grabbed the opening goal in Turin after just three minutes and added a second on the hour with a sensational overhead kick, – as the reigning European champions put themselves in the driver’s seat as they look to defend their European crown.
Cristiano Ronaldo became the first player to score in 10 successive Champions League games as he struck twice for holders Real Madrid in a 3-0 win at Juventus, yesterday’s quarter-final first leg, taking him to 14 goals in this season’s competition.
Juventus forward Paulo Dybala was sent off on 66 minutes before Ronaldo set up Marcelo to cap the rout and leave Real in complete control of the tie going into the second leg in Madrid on April 11.
Already, many see the second leg as a mere formality but never say never as far as football is concerned.
